Verse Text
29. parikramo, yathā tatraiva—
viṣṇuṁ pradakṣinī-kurvan yas tatrāvartate punaḥ |
tad evāvartanaṁ tasya punar nāvartate bhave ||135||
Translation
Circumambulation (verse 85), from Hari-bhakti-sudhodaya: If a person circumambulates Viṣṇu and returns to the same spot, that returning guarantees that he does not return to another birth.
Purport (Nectar of Devotion)
Circumambulating the Temple of Viṣṇu
It is said in the Hari-bhakti-sudhodaya, “A person who is circumambulating the Deity of Viṣṇu can counteract the circumambulation of repeated birth and death in this material world.” The conditioned soul is circumambulating through repeated births and deaths on account of his material existence, and this can be counteracted simply by circumambulating the Deity in the temple.
